There are 100 x 1000 = 100000 centimetres in a kilometre.1 kilometre = 100,000 centimetres
To convert centimetres to kilometres, you would divide the number by 100,000. So, for example, 1,000,000 centimetres is equal to 10 kilometres. Similarly, 7 centimetres is equal to 0.00007 kilometres.

First you need to know the "scale" size, example 1/4, 1/5, 1/8, 1/10, 1/12 etc. For example a 1/4 scale car going 25mph in real life is going 100 scale mph. So 225 mph scale speed if it were a 1/10 model you would divide by 10 and get 22.5 real mph. If you know the true speed and scale you multiply by that number. Example 1/10 scale going 22.5 real mph x 10 = 225 mph scale speed.
